Calculateur de PI sur un cluster FPGA

Encadrants : 

Occurrences : 

2015

Nombre d'étudiants minimum: 

3

Nombre d'étudiants maximum: 

4

Nombre d'instances : 

1

Pour ceux qui se sont bien amusés avec les cartes FPGA pendant les TPS de PAN, la fête continue. On va connecter 16 de ces cartes en utilisant le réseau ethernet et implementer des calculs parallèles distribués. Chacune de ces puces contient, en plus du FPGA, un processeur ARM embarqué qui va faciliter notre tâche. On commencera avec un K2000 distribué sur toutes les cartes et ensuite on passera aux choses sérieuses: calculer la valeur de PI avec le maximum de précision, un problème classique et universel.

Le but est de calculer un nombre maximum de décimales de PI en un minimum de temps. Il faut savoir que le record mondial pour cet exercice, détenu par un certain "Houkouonchi", a été établi en Octobre 2014 et qu'il s'élève à 13,3x10^12 chiffres après la virgule, avec un temps de calcul de 208 jours sur une station de travail utilisant des dualcore Xeon.

La liste des records est visible sur ce site : http://www.numberworld.org/y-cruncher/